Come and hear Sahar Vardi, Israeli conscientious objector and peace activist, talk on Tuesday 27th September at 7.30pm at the Friends Meeting House, 43 St Giles, Oxford OX1 3LW

Based in Jerusalem, Sahar coordinates the Israel programme for the American Friends Service Committee (AFSC), focusing on countering the militarisation of Israeli society. Sahar started protesting against Israel’s treatment of the Palestinian people at a very young age, joining her father doing agricultural work with Palestinian villagers, mainly planting trees. She was conscripted to the Israeli Defence Forces at age 18 but publicly refused to serve and spent several months in military prison for conscientious objection in 2008. 

Since then, Sahar has been active with several Israeli peace and human rights groups . Today much of her activism is in Jerusalem in Palestinian-led struggles against house demolitions, child arrest and acts of discrimination against East Jerusalem Palestinian residents.

Sahar Vardi has been invited to the UK by the Amos Trust http://www.amostrust.org/about/
